Ingredients You’ll Need for This Chipotle Lime Chicken Burrito Bowl

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on chipotle powder
  • Juice of 2 limes
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 4 cups cooked brown rice or quinoa
  • 1 can black beans, rinsed and drained
  • 1 cup corn, canned or frozen
  • 1 avocado, sliced
  • 1 cup diced tomatoes
  • Fresh cilantro, for garnish
  • Optional toppings: shredded cheese, sour cream, salsa

Steps to Create Your Chipotle Lime Chicken Burrito Bowl

  1. Start by marinating the chicken. Combine olive oil, chipotle powder, garlic powder, onion powder, lime juice, salt, and pepper in a bowl. Add the chicken, cover, and let it sit for at least 30 minutes.
  2. Preheat your grill or a skillet over medium heat. Once hot, add the marinated chicken and cook for 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F. Remove from heat and let it rest for a few minutes.
  3. While the chicken is resting, prepare your rice or quinoa according to package instructions. If you’re using frozen corn, heat it in the microwave or on a stovetop until warm.
  4. Slice the chicken into strips. In a large bowl, layer the rice or quinoa, followed by the black beans, corn, diced tomatoes, and sliced chicken.
  5. Top with avocado slices and sprinkle fresh cilantro over the bowl. Add any optional toppings you like.
  6. Serve immediately and enjoy your homemade Chipotle Lime Chicken Burrito Bowl!

Tips for Making the Best Chipotle Lime Chicken Burrito Bowl

When it comes to this dish, prep is key. I like to marinate the chicken the night before to really let those flavors soak in. If you’re short on time, even an hour will work wonders. Another tip is to have all your toppings ready to go. Having everything prepped makes assembling the bowls quick and fun!

Storage and Reheating Tips

Leftovers? No problem! Store the ingredients separately in airtight containers to keep everything fresh. You can keep the cooked chicken for about 3-4 days in the fridge. When you’re ready to dig in, simply reheat the chicken in the microwave or on the stovetop until warmed through. Just remember, fresh avocado doesn’t store well, so add that just before serving!

Is the Chipotle Lime Chicken Burrito Bowl gluten-free?

Yes, this burrito bowl can be made gluten-free by ensuring that all ingredients, including sauces and toppings, are gluten-free. Brown rice and quinoa are naturally gluten-free.
